"I am the door”

There are not many ways to God. There is only one Door. "I am the door; if anyone enters through Me, he will be saved, and will go in and out and find pasture".

You must believe in Christ to be saved. We are not trusting in things to be saved. The Door is a person, the Lord Jesus Christ. He becomes ours through believing on Him. The only thing necessary is to believe or trust in Jesus Christ. Have you believed or trusted in Him for everlasting life?

John 10:7-10 (NKJV) “Then Jesus said to them again, “Most assuredly, I say to you, I am the door of the sheep. 8 All who ever came before Me are thieves and robbers, but the sheep did not hear them. 9 I am the door. If anyone enters by Me, he will be saved, and will go in and out and find pasture. 10 The thief does not come except to steal, and to kill, and to destroy. I have come that they may have life, and that they may have it more abundantly.”

When Jesus speaks about giving us an abundant life, He's telling us that He offers us new life in Him that is far better than we would have ever expected it to be. Abundant life is a life characterised by an eternal, unbreakable relationship with Him. Those who enjoy this relationship can find joy in every circumstance, hope during every trial, and help whenever it is needed.

The abundant life Christ offers is a life characterised by growth, maturity, transformation, and spiritual strength. He takes us from spiritual infancy and develops us into spiritual leaders. He found us when we were dead, and He gives us life. He found us when we were enslaved to weakness, and He blessed us with His strength. We may not have every material thing we want in this world, but if we have Christ, we have everything we truly need.

In Jesus, you are secure for time and eternity. So, do not fear, for our Redeemer defeated the one who can destroy body and soul. United to the Door of life everlasting, a living hope now stirs inside us.

1 Peter 1:3 (NLT) “All praise to God, the Father of our Lord Jesus Christ. It is by his great mercy that we have been born again, because God raised Jesus Christ from the dead. Now we live with great expectation,”

A deep joy. John 16:24 (NLT) “You haven’t done this before. Ask, using my name, and you will receive, and you will have abundant joy And a love beyond all knowledge dwells.

Ephesians 3:19 (NLV) “I pray that you will know the love of Christ. His love goes beyond anything we can understand. I pray that you will be filled with God Himself.”
